Hublot Announces Big Bang e Blue Victory, the New Official Watch of the Japan National Football Team

Nov 1, 2022
Swiss luxury watch brand Hublot has been the official watch provider for the Japan National Football Team since 2015. Hublot has now announced its newest connected watch, the Big Bang e Bleu Victory.


As the official watch worn by Japan National Football Team players, the Big Bang e Bleu Victory, as its name suggests, will keep time alongside the Japan National Team as they strive for victory on the stage of their dreams. The dial, case, and strap feature a blue inspired by the team's color, SAMURAI BLUE. The 44mm blue ceramic case, inspired by Hublot's iconic mechanical Big Bang watch, is paired with a calfskin and rubber strap, a first for the Big Bang e, for a luxurious yet sporty look. It also includes a black rubber strap for easy strap changes using Hublot's exclusive One Click system. The Big Bang e Bleu Victory is the third generation of Hublot's Big Bang e connected watch collection, making it the most sophisticated and exciting Big Bang e to date. Featuring an improved, high-definition screen and a newly designed dedicated football app, it allows you to capture every glorious moment of the match. Instead of a cutting-edge mechanical watch movement, this model features the Qualcomm® Snapdragon Wear™ 4100 and the latest version of Wear OS by Google™ (Wear OS 3). Additionally, the watch boasts a comprehensive hardware spec, including an accelerometer, gyroscope, microphone, speaker, GPS, and heart rate monitor. To take advantage of these sensor features, the watch is pre-programmed with the Strava app, the leading platform for athletes and the world's largest sports community, with over 100 million athletes in 195 countries. Strava tracks and analyzes performance across over 30 sports, including running, cycling, swimming, and the recently added soccer. Equipped with Bluetooth 5.0, it connects to a variety of devices and accessories. A suite of preloaded apps keeps you connected, allowing you to track your activity, health, and more. Google Play also offers access to many more great apps right on your watch.


This smartwatch boasts a day-long battery life and takes approximately two hours to fully charge from empty. After five seconds of inactivity, the watch automatically switches to "low power mode" to conserve battery life. This unique timepiece offers exceptional legibility, ergonomics, and elegant, interactive features. It's compatible with Android and iOS and is water resistant to 3 ATM. iOS functionality and compatibility may vary by device.

Hublot has served as the Official Timekeeper of the FIFA World Cup for four consecutive tournaments, and this year it will once again serve as the timekeeper for all 64 matches of the FIFA World Cup Qatar 2022™, including the final at Lusail Stadium in Doha on December 18. The 129 official referees will be wearing Hublot's new connected watch, the Big Bang e FIFA World Cup Qatar 2022™, to time the matches.



Big Bang e Bleu Victory Product Overview
Model Number: 450.EX.1100.VR.JFA22
Material: Dark blue ceramic case,
Blue calfskin x black rubber strap, one replacement black rubber strap included
Price: 792,000 yen (tax included) *Limited to 150 pieces in Japan
